3 Live Local Towers With Nearly 1,400 Units Approved By Wynwood Board
Miami’s Wynwood Design Review Committee reviewed a proposal for three new towers at its June 3 meeting, and voted 4-1 to recommend approval. LIVWRK, a company based in Brooklyn, New York, is the developer planning the towers. The board also added a condition to its recommendation: more local art should be incorporated at the street level to further enhance the existing Wynwood streetscape.
